Günümüz dijital dünyasında, yüksek performanslı sunucular, web siteleri ve uygulamalar için kritik bir öneme sahiptir. Bu makalede, yüksek performanslı bir sunucunun nasıl kurulacağını detaylı bir şekilde açıklayacağız. Kurulumumuz, AlmaLinux işletim sistemi üzerine cPanel veya Plesk kontrol paneli ile gerçekleştirilecektir.
1. Sorunun Kaynağı: Yüksek Performans Gereksinimleri
Yüksek performanslı sunucular, genellikle yoğun trafik alan web siteleri veya uygulamalar için gereklidir. Performansı etkileyen başlıca faktörler arasında işlemci hızı, bellek miktarı, depolama hızı ve ağ bağlantısı bulunmaktadır. Sunucu yapılandırmalarında yapılacak yanlışlıklar, performans kaybına neden olabilir.
2. Gerekli Ön Hazırlıklar
Kurulum işlemine geçmeden önce, aşağıdaki adımları takip edin:
AlmaLinux işletim sistemini edinin ve yükleyin.
SSH ile sunucunuza bağlanın.
Gerekli güncellemeleri yapın:
sudo dnf update -y
3. cPanel veya Plesk Kurulumu
Bu bölümde, cPanel ve Plesk kurulumlarını detaylandıracağız.
3.1. cPanel Kurulumu
cPanel kurulumuna geçmeden önce, gerekli bağımlılıkları yükleyin:
sudo dnf install perl
Ardından, cPanel kurulum dosyasını indirin ve kurun:
wget -N http://httpupdate.cpanel.net/latest
sh latest
Kurulum tamamlandıktan sonra, cPanel'in yönetim paneline erişmek için:
https://your-server-ip:2087
adresine gidin.
3.2. Plesk Kurulumu
Plesk kurulumu için aşağıdaki komutları kullanın:
sh <(curl https://autoinstall.plesk.com/one-click-installer)
Plesk kurulumunu tamamladıktan sonra, yönetim paneline erişmek için:
https://your-server-ip:8443
adresini kullanın.
4. Performans Optimizasyonu
Kurulumdan sonra, sunucunuzun performansını artırmak için birkaç optimizasyon yapmalısınız:
4.1. LiteSpeed Web Sunucusu Kurulumu
LiteSpeed, yüksek performans sağlayan bir web sunucusudur. Aşağıdaki komut ile kurulum yapabilirsiniz:
MySQL'in performansını artırmak için, my.cnf dosyasında değişiklik yapmalısınız:
sudo nano /etc/my.cnf
Aşağıdaki satırları ekleyin veya güncelleyin:
[mysqld]
innodb_buffer_pool_size=1G
query_cache_size=128M
5. Güvenlik Önlemleri
Yüksek performanslı sunucunuzun güvenliğini artırmak için aşağıdaki adımları izleyin:
Güçlü bir SSH şifresi belirleyin.
UFW veya iptables ile güvenlik duvarı kuralları oluşturun.
SSL sertifikası kurulumunu gerçekleştirin:
sudo dnf install mod_ssl
Sonuç
Bu makalede, yüksek performanslı bir sunucunun kurulumunu adım adım inceledik. Doğru yapılandırma ve optimizasyon ile sunucunuzun performansını artırabilir, güvenliğini sağlayabilirsiniz. Unutmayın, sunucu yönetimi sürekli bir süreçtir ve düzenli bakımlar yapılmalıdır.